HR Operations Lead
We are looking for an experienced and detail-oriented HR Operations Lead to join Creative Dock and play a key role in ensuring the smooth, efficient, and data-driven execution of HR operations. This role is critical in driving HR controlling, compensation management, and data integrity, enabling informed decision-making and supporting compliance across the organization.
Responsibilities and Duties
Lead and coordinate day-to-day HR Operations activities, ensuring efficient and consistent execution across all processes.
Support, guide, and develop the HR Operations team, providing clear prioritization with a hands-on approach.
-
Own HR controlling and cost management, including:
Compensation cost planning and forecasting
Cost roll-forward and variance analysis
Participation in financial planning cycles and regular cost reviews
Oversee and maintain compensation structures, including grading and salary frameworks, ensuring internal consistency.
Act as the HR data owner, ensuring accuracy, consistency, and integrity of HR data across systems and processes.
Manage and continuously improve HR reporting, delivering both regular and ad hoc reports for Finance, HR Business Partners, and leadership.
Partner with Finance and other stakeholders to build and maintain HR data dashboards, ensuring clear and effective communication of insights.
Identify opportunities for process improvements and automation within HR operations and reporting.
Ensure compliance and proper documentation of HR processes.
Support the administration and governance of bonus schemes and company-wide HR policies.
Coordinate with external providers (e.g., payroll, benefits) to ensure smooth and accurate HR operations delivery.
Essential Qualifications and Skills
Bachelor’s degree in HR or a related discipline.
Minimum of 5 years of experience in a relevant HR role.
Fluent in English and Czech.
Strong understanding of HR processes across the employee lifecycle.
Knowledge of labor law.
Proven experience with budgeting and cost analysis.
Solid understanding of compensation structures (grading, rating, etc.).
Advanced data analysis and reporting skills.
Experience with HR systems (HRIS) and data management.

Company Overview
Creative Dock is a venture builder that creates, builds, and scales new businesses. We combine corporate strength with startup agility to deliver innovative solutions and drive growth. Our teams are made up of entrepreneurial thinkers who are passionate about turning ideas into impactful businesses.
